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08836569 789974242 7934800
568193 39371509733 29931949062
568193 39371509733 29931949062
010 18552 28255953393
All about undefined
Interested in learning more?
568193 39371509733 29931949062
010 18552 28255953393
See more
2433804514 5846028867
62410 52225343 910
See more
42 4350023
0228064585 55 620342377
See more